The Hotel Rigopiano was a special place. Trip Advisor users gave it four stars for its “relaxing isolation” and “mind blowing mountain spa experience.” But in mid- January, the Rigopiano wasn’t at full capacity, and those who were there weren’t the usual Trip Advisor clients.
It is off- season, after the holidays and before the traditional February ski week vacations, so the guests were local people from Abruzzo who enjoy long weekends at discount between- season prices. More than 4. 0 relatives of victims of those trapped in the still- buried hotel, almost all from towns within a 1.
Penne, the largest village in close range. There they await word of anyone pulled alive from the buried hotel. Some of those trapped inside the hotel were there because their homes were destroyed in earthquakes that struck the region in October. Others whose homes were destroyed in earthquakes here in August were on a weeklong holiday before getting back to work rebuilding their homes, according to the Italian newswire ANSA. But because the narrow mountain roads are under more than six feet of snow and blocked by fallen trees from the avalanche, rescuers have struggled to get heavy equipment up to the area to try to move the roof of the hotel from its collapsed walls to look for survivors. Other responders were dropped in by helicopter with cadaver dogs, which haven’t been able to pick up any scents so far due to the cold. Instead, as they wait for heavy equipment to arrive, rescuers have spent hours yelling into the ruined structure, hoping to hear something—anything—from inside. Because of blinding snow and subzero temperatures, the rescuers are working abbreviated shifts to avoid frostbite and other cold- related ailments.
